Instructions
  1. Thoroughly rinse the lentils.
  2. Boil lentils in the water for 20 minutes until they’re soft and most of the water is gone.
  3. Preheat oven to 400 degrees after the lentils have finished cooking.
  4. Finely chop the shallots and carrots. We used a food processor.
  5. Saute the shallots and carrots in the oil until soft. About 5 minutes.
  6. In a mixing bowl, combine the cooked ingredients with the black pepper, soy sauce, oats and bread crumbs.
  7. Form the mixture into 6 patties and place on a baking sheet coated with non-stick cooking spray or parchment paper
  8. Bake at 400 degrees for 15 minutes.
  9. Serve with sliced tomatoes, lettuce and your favorite condiment.
Recipe Notes

Serving size is 1 lentil burger.
